    GUIDE:How to transfer contacts from Microsoft Outlook to Gmail

    I'm sitting here in the office, its the end of the year in the school system, and several employees transferring to alternative counties. With this it brings loads of transferring contacts to take with them from their company phone. Well, this one in particular sparked a guide idea. So here it is, How to transfer Outlook contacts to your Gmail account.


    Step 1: Sign in to your outlook account.
    step 2 In the top left hand corner click File > Import/Export > Export to file > Browse to desired place to save your file > export. Be sure you export the file as .csv (comma separated values)
    Step 3 Log into your Gmail account
    Step 4 Select 'Contacts' In the subsection you will see a 'Import' button on the right-hand side. Click it.
    Step 5 Browse to the location where you saved it > Open it > Click Import.

    Lost Folder in Outlook 2010

    I have never had such a problem so I probably cannot help you.

    I assume that the list of datafiles is correct [In Outlook 2007 this is given in several places including File, Data file management] and that you have run ScanPST on each of the pst/ost files shown there.

    Are there any references to the missing file in the ScanPST log [log settings are under Options in the ScanPST UI]?

    In Outlook 2007, I can set the 'navigation pane' to 'Folder list' view so that I can manually look through every open file & folder to check their contents. If you can find it this way but not when searching then it would indicate a search problem rather than a pst file problem. I have not seen this but I'd run Office diagnostics [2007] & the Windows indexing troubleshooter if I did.
    - Apparently, Office diagnostics itself does not exist in Office 2010. I understand that, for Office 2010, you'd need to go to Control panel, Progs & features then right-click on the Office 2010 entry so you could select Repair.
    - I have also seen a suggestion that Office diagnostics might be in your Start menu but I don't know if that was correct or not.
    - The Windows indexing troubleshooter is at Settings, Updates, Troubleshoot, Search & indexing
